## Tuning Retry Behavior

Plugins built against the Lendwick gateway must attach an idempotency key to every payment retry. The key is derived from the merchant transaction reference plus a retry epoch, so duplicate submissions within the retention window are collapsed server-side. Authors should not generate fresh keys on retry; doing so defeats deduplication entirely. The defaults below work for most integrations, but high-volume plugins may adjust them. The current tuning constants are:

limits module of yadug-tawip:
QUOTAS = {
    "julael": 705,
    "kasael": 903,
    "druwyn": 489,
}

14:22 — The Harbridge user module was carved out of the Ostrel monolith and deployed behind a shadow proxy. Session reads briefly dual-wrote to both stores, causing a 4-minute spike in stale profile responses. Mira flipped the read flag to the new service and latency recovered. The deploy in question carries the trace token below.

session token of kageg-tahop = htk14_af3c1ccccb7dcf

Handover — Vexler partner SFTP drop

Ownership moves to you today. Drop runs hourly from Vexler's end into the intake bucket via the relay host. Watch for zero-byte files; their exporter flakes on Mondays. Creds live in the ops vault, path noted in the runbook. Vault auto-seals after 48h idle. Support escalations go to the on-call rotation, not me. If the vault is sealed when you need it, unseal with the recovery passphrase below.

recovery phrase for tadug-fafof: zorwyn-kasion

**Ticket: Reconcilo nightly job — sign-off required**

The inventory reconciliation job for the Hallowmere warehouse feed now runs idempotently; re-runs no longer double-count restocks. Changes: lock acquired per SKU batch, mismatch report written before any writes, and a dry-run flag for future maintainers. Note: the job assumes the upstream Crateline export lands by 03:30 — if that changes, adjust the scheduler guard, not the job itself. This cannot ship to production until sign-off is recorded from the person below.

account owner for bawip-tahag: Raleth Quenok